Sand & Sage Fair and Rodeo – Lamar, Colorado

Parade and Rodeo Dates are not the same. I’ve noted this elsewhere on the site, but I thought it might be good to make a note of the differences here, so you could find them if you’re driving in from out of town. Sand & Sage Parade will be Saturday, August 8, 2009 – 10 AM (they didn’t change that) so get up and bring the kiddies out to the parade. We have some special events and plans for this year’s parade going on, and you won’t want to miss them. Come on out and join us for a fun and exciting time seeing neighbors again. Sand & Sage Rodeo will take place on the following Friday and Saturday nights (August 14 & 15, 2009) at the Sand & Sage Fair Grounds. Parking is in direct competition with the World Series Ball Park, and they have guarded parking areas. The county has cleared another parking area on the west side of 9th Street for more parking and will have the usual parking available north of the Pavilion.

World Series Excitement Surrounds Lamar, Colorado

Workers laughed and played around the ball fields as they finished up the Valley National Bank field and concrete walkways Tuesday in Lamar, Colorado. “World Series 2009 WILL happen,” Warren Camp stated as he dredge floated the concrete one more time, assuring a smooth surface for foot traffic. Valley National Bank field will be the only field finished in time for the Cal Ripken 2009 World Series coming to Lamar in mid August.
